Environment:
Doc Watson's has the feel of an Irish Pub the second you walk through the doors. Dim lighting, a couple booths and tables, a stage for entertainment, and a nice sized bar make up the first floor. There are plenty of televisions so there are no worries of missing a game, just standard worries of losing one. Music is always playing from the jukebox, or live bands. The upstairs has another bar, jukebox, televisions, and some pooltables. The food is really good and is standard pub fare with some Irish twists. The scene dictated by the music that is either playing live or selected by drinkers on the jukebox. Each floor has a different jukebox so you can choose the tunes that better suit you (its mostly rock 'n roll). Overall, the staff, scenery, and delicious drinks and fare make Doc Watson's a definite Irish hotspot.
